A 12-year-old boy escapes months of torture by his mother and stepfather in Kemerovo—found shivering and starving in a supermarket storeroom, his face slashed and bones broken. As both adults land in pre-trial detention, we examine the medical evidence, the neighbors’ silence, and how a child who hadn’t seen a school or clinic in years slipped past every safeguard.
